There are no results for Spain Horchata
- Check your spelling or try different keywords
Ref A: 62F66AC456DE464A8720FB36AE746A82 Ref B: SG2EDGE1615 Ref C: 2025-02-20T18:21:24Z
Ref A: 62F66AC456DE464A8720FB36AE746A82 Ref B: SG2EDGE1615 Ref C: 2025-02-20T18:21:24Z